BBC 1’s The Greatest Dancer is facing the chop after just two series due to falling ratings. The show, featuring Cheryl Tweedy and Oti Mabuse as “dance captains”, has struggled up against rival show The Voice in the Saturday night prime time battle.
It pulled in just 2.8million viewers for its final episode at the weekend — as ballroom and Latin dancers Michael and Jowita lifted the crown.
The programme was beaten by long-running BBC hospital drama Casualty and was down by more than a million. Crew on the series, hosted by Alesha Dixon and Jordan Banjo, have been told not to expect future work on the show.
